Gilman WI tornado...F1/F2The tornado (ranked an F2 at its peak) initially touched down about a mile northwest of Gilman, WI (approximately 5:10 pm) and then moved through Gilman where it blew a roof off of the high school (5:12 pm) and damaged trees...homes... and power lines. The tornado damage in Gilman was ranked as a strong F1.
The tornado then continued intermittently east southeast from Gilman through Chequamegon National Forest. Prior to dissipating, the tornado damaged a house and trees about 7 miles west of Medford. This was somewhere between 5:45 pm and 6 pm. It was here that the tornado produced F2 damage.
The tornado path length was approximately 16 to 17 miles.
